Deal Details
Update: This popular deal is still available for most; however, some users may not be able to add the deice to cart (trying a different web browser/device is recommended, but not guaranteed to work).

Metro by T-Mobile offers its 128GB Apple iPhone 13 5G Smartphone (Midnight, Locked) for Free when purchased together with 1-Month of their $55/ Month Unlimited Prepaid Plan when you join Metro, Add a Line to Your Existing Metro account, or Port Your Existing Phone Number. Shipping is free.

Thanks to community member lxtng for finding this deal.
  • Note: Plan costs $55 for the first month and $50/month with AutoPay (optional). You must join Metro on a $55/ Month Plan or higher to qualify for the free device.
Specs:
  • 6.1" 2532x1170 Super Retina XDR OLED Touchscreen Display
  • A15 Bionic Chipset
  • 4GB RAM
  • 128GB Internal Storage
  • Advanced Dual-Camera System
  • 5G Connectivity
  • Smart HDR 4
  • IP68 Water Resistance
  •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6 w/ Bluetooth 5.0
  • Supports MagSafe Accessories
  • Apple iOS 15 (upgradable to latest iOS 18 update)
Unlocking:
  • Currently, device will unlock after 365 days from the date of plan activation. No need to pay for additional service after first month/initial activation (see unlock policy). Note that terms may be subject to change at any time.

Porting and failed attempts to order the phone. FYI if you go through the last step and Metro reserved the number you are porting in. But you failed, their payment screen and your order did not go through. Be advised that that number(s) that you attempted to port (no atter how many different phone numbers) are locked in Metro Port Reservation. YOU WILL NOT BE ABLE TO USE THAT NUMBER to process new order using that same # until you call Metro and ask to be transferred over to the porting department and ask them to delete the port. You will also not be able to port it anywhere else until they delete the port reservation. So, all you folks that tried to process a zillion orders after your initial order failed it will never work (even if you fix why your payment didn't go through) until YOU CALL METRO to fix your PORT. With all that said the port dept will want to verify you and the easiest way is for them to send you a SMS to your metro phone so your you don't have a Metro phone working well welcome to the struggle bus have a seat and relax your gong to be on the phone with Metro for some time. Please know this address multiple attempts at porting the same phone number not all the other reasons orders fail on the payment screen. All I can say on that one is , Don't use VPN, don't use discover, don't use a virtual number, wait 48 not 24 hours for your last order attempt to clear out of their system and if you are a religious person…pray

The short version, you must call Metro to make sure any/all the number(s) you are porting over that previously succeed Port Reservation but failed Payment are not locked now to metro reservation once locked to metro they will not work with a new order or another wireless company.
